Idk man, its hard to make the argument that Jamgrass/newgrass isnt a thing when you got bands like Shadowgrass, Kitchen Dwellers, Fireside Collective and Mountain Grass Unit. There are so many examples but it really got momentum with YMSB before Jeff died. They paved the way for a lot of these younger bands. Bluegrass has always had this improvisational aspect to it, but a lot of these bands are leaning heavily on the psychedelic jams. I’m also a firm believer that you don’t need electric instruments in order to jam. Even though they still very much respect it and incorporate traditional Bluegrass into their performances, theres a huge difference between traditional bluegrass and what a lot of these bands are doing today.
